Property Overview: 371 Campbell Street, North River Heights

Key Characteristics & Appeal

This home at 371 Campbell Street is a compact, character property built in 1928, situated on a standard 4,500 sqft lot in the established North River Heights neighbourhood. Its primary appeal lies in its position as a relatively affordable entry point into a desirable area. With a living area of 786 sqft, it is notably smaller than most homes on its street and in the wider neighbourhood, which suggests a cozy, low-maintenance interior. The assessed value of $365k is below average for North River Heights, yet aligns closely with the Winnipeg city-wide average, indicating a price point that reflects the home's scale rather than its location.

This property would suit first-time buyers, downsizers, or investors seeking a foothold in a prime neighbourhood without the premium typically attached to larger homes. Its smaller size and lot offer manageable upkeep, while its age presents the charm and potential renovation opportunities of a classic Winnipeg build. A thoughtful perspective for a buyer is to see the below-average metrics not as drawbacks, but as the reason for its accessibility; you are purchasing the location and community, with the home itself representing a canvas for personalization or a practical, efficient living space.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Is the assessed value the same as the market value?
No. The assessed value ($365k) is for municipal tax purposes. Market value is determined by what a buyer is willing to pay in the current market, which can be higher or lower.

2. How does the smaller living area impact livability?
The 786 sqft footprint is efficient and manageable, likely featuring a classic layout. It’s ideal for individuals, couples, or small families comfortable with cozy spaces, but may require creative solutions for storage or workspace.

3. What are the implications of the home being built in 1928?
You can expect character details but should also budget for potential updates to older systems like wiring, plumbing, or insulation. A thorough pre-purchase inspection is highly recommended.
